Lat/Long: 55.95370102, … WebCorstorphine Hill LNR is in the northwest of Edinburgh is 76ha and rises to 162 metres. It is bounded by Queensferry Road in the north and Corstorphine Road in the south. Edinburgh Zoo sits on its southern slope. This predominantly woodland site consists of mostly oak and birch. There are areas of open ground consisting bare rock and grassland.
